CVIJANOVIĆ VISITS THE CHURCH OF THE HOLY SEPULCHRE IN JERUSALEM, PLEASED TO BEGIN VISIT TO ISRAEL THERE

JERUSALEM, JUNE 20 /SRNA/ – The Serb BiH Presidency member Željka Cvijanović began her visit to Israel by visiting the Church of the Holy Sepulchre in Jerusalem, where she prayed that the Lord grant the Serb people health, peace, prosperity, wisdom, harmony, and unity.

Cvijanović noted that the Church of the Holy Sepulchre is one of the holiest sites in Christianity and said she was immensely pleased to begin her visit to Israel at that very place. “While praying at this holy site, I wished that the Lord would grant our people, all families, and citizens of Republika Srpska health, peace and prosperity, faith and wisdom, harmony and unity, as a firm foundation upon which we will build a stable, secure, and even more successful future,” Cvijanović posted on Instagram. Cvijanović pointed out that this holy place has for centuries brought together pilgrims from around the world, reminding them of the light of Christ’s Resurrection, the triumph of life over death, and the power of faith to overcome all trials.
